QMB1001 – Business Mathematics is a 3-credit applied mathematics course covering the calculations business actually uses: percentages, markup and markdown, discounts, payroll, simple and compound interest, annuities, loans and amortization, depreciation, inventory, taxes, insurance, and basic financial statement arithmetic.
The course is deliberately practical, and its value is easy to underestimate. Most of the mathematics is individually simple — the difficulty is not algebraic but in knowing which calculation applies, setting it up correctly, and interpreting the result. A student who can compute a percentage but cannot tell whether the situation calls for markup on cost or margin on selling price will get the right arithmetic on the wrong problem, which in business is worse than not calculating at all.
Content covers fundamentals review — fractions, decimals, percentages, and equations; percentage applications — increase, decrease, base, rate, and portion; trade and cash discounts — series discounts and terms; markup and markdown — on cost versus on selling price, and margin; payroll — gross pay, overtime, commission, piece rate, withholding, and employer taxes; simple interest — and promissory notes; compound interest — future and present value, and compounding frequency; annuities — ordinary and due, future and present value, and sinking funds; installment loans and amortization — payment calculation and schedules; consumer credit — APR, finance charges, and credit card arithmetic; mortgages — payment, amortization, and total cost; depreciation — straight-line, units of production, and declining balance; inventory valuation — FIFO, LIFO, and average; taxes — sales, property, and income basics; insurance — premiums and coinsurance; financial statement analysis — basic ratios and vertical and horizontal analysis; and business statistics basics — averages, index numbers, and graph interpretation.

QMB1001 is an applied business mathematics course, not a general education mathematics course. Florida general education mathematics requirements are typically satisfied by MAC1105 College Algebra, MGF1106/MGF1107 Mathematics for Liberal Arts, or STA2023 Statistics — and business mathematics generally does not substitute for any of them.
Two consequences. A student in a College Credit Certificate or applied A.S. program may need exactly this course and nothing more. A student intending to transfer into a business bachelor's will still need College Algebra, and frequently statistics and a business calculus course (MAC2233 Survey of Calculus is the common one) as well. SCNS equivalency applies to the same number at the same level, never across numbers — and equivalency does not make a course satisfy a requirement it was never designed for. Ask an advisor which mathematics your specific program and intended transfer destination require before registering.
The single most practically important distinction in the course, and one that working businesspeople get wrong regularly. Markup on cost expresses the added amount as a percentage of what you paid; margin expresses it as a percentage of what you charge. They are not the same, and the gap widens as the number rises.
A retailer who intends a 40 percent margin but applies a 40 percent markup to cost ends up with a margin near 29 percent — a shortfall that is invisible per item and substantial across a year. Students should be able to convert between the two fluently, know which convention a given industry uses (retail generally talks margin; some trades talk markup), and always ask "percentage of what?" when a number is quoted. This alone justifies the course for anyone who will price anything.
The chapter most worth taking personally. Compound interest works in both directions, and the arithmetic that makes retirement savings grow is the same arithmetic that makes credit card balances grow.
Concrete implications worth working out with real numbers: a credit card at a typical APR, paid at the minimum, takes many years and costs multiples of the original balance — and the statement is legally required to tell you so, which is a disclosure most people never read. A thirty-year mortgage's total interest frequently approaches or exceeds the principal. And on the other side, the difference between beginning retirement contributions at 25 versus 35 is far larger than the ten years of contributions, because of compounding.
Students who run these calculations on their own loans and statements retain the material permanently, and instructors who assign that exercise are giving students something more valuable than the credit.
Where students lose points, and it is not arithmetic. Given a word problem, the work is deciding which quantity is which: what is the base, is the rate applied to cost or to price, is this an ordinary annuity or an annuity due, is the question asking for the payment or the total. The calculation that follows is usually one line.
The method that works: read the problem twice, write down what is given and what is asked with units and labels, identify the formula or concept, estimate the answer roughly before calculating, then compute and check the estimate. That last step catches most errors — a monthly payment of $12,000 on a $20,000 car loan is a setup error, not a rounding error. Show your work; partial credit depends on it, and so does finding your own mistakes.

Practical career advice. Exams may require a financial calculator, but in actual business work almost nothing is done on one — it is done in Excel. The functions that cover this entire course are few: PMT, FV, PV, RATE, NPER, plus basic arithmetic and percentage formatting.
A student who leaves able to build an amortization schedule, a payroll calculation, and a markup pricing sheet in a spreadsheet has something demonstrable in a job interview, and it generalizes far beyond this course. Building each chapter's calculations as a small spreadsheet is also an unusually effective way to study, because a formula that is wrong produces visibly wrong output.
The QMB prefix covers quantitative methods in business; QMB1001 is the applied business mathematics course, while QMB2100 and QMB3200 are business statistics courses at the lower and upper division. General education mathematics runs under MAC, MGF, and STA prefixes, and developmental mathematics under MAT0 numbers. SCNS equivalency applies to the same number at the same level, never across numbers. Because this course is applied rather than general education, confirm with an advisor how it counts in your program and whether your transfer destination requires College Algebra, statistics, or business calculus in addition.
